Accident summary

On Wednesday 2 October 2002 at 06:20 a slight collision occurred near B 4270, Vale of Glamorgan involving 1 vehicle (peugeot 306) and 1 casualty (1 slight) Weather at the time was recorded as fog or mist. Road surface conditions were wet or damp. Lighting was described as darkness - lighting unknown. A police officer attended the scene.
